Why I Built This Site Instead of Selling the Compressors

I looked at stocking GX Pump compressors. The math doesn't work for a small business.

Amazon's third-party sellers sell the CS4-I at prices I can't match when you factor in my overhead. They offer free shipping on a heavy item that would cost me real money to ship. And the third-party warranty programs on Amazon — where a buyer can buy an extended warranty at checkout and get a replacement unit shipped if something goes wrong — are genuinely better than what I can offer as a local dealer. Customers have told me this directly: they bought the compressor on Amazon specifically because of the warranty situation.

I can't compete with that. Rather than pretend I can or just stay silent, I built this site. I give you my professional knowledge — what to buy, what to watch for, how to use it right — and I send you to Amazon for the actual purchase. I earn a small affiliate commission on qualifying sales. That's the deal. It's transparent and it works for everyone.

Filters are non-negotiable

I will always tell you to run an inline filter. I have seen too many airguns damaged by moisture and oil from compressors. This is one of those things where skipping it to save $30 will cost you $300 or more down the road.
